Output d56b61deedfd2d9186ae523a7b77db61c971b9c7c836c04937bd8df29daa3332:1

value
180000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e32152b5544579b5dab149a1068dd0ced55cdcab OP_EQUALVERIFY OP_CHECKSIG
address
1MhxJsfxaQ2xYf8ibQhojHL6gJzGviMuT9
transaction
d56b61deedfd2d9186ae523a7b77db61c971b9c7c836c04937bd8df29daa3332
spent
true